New King of Slackline
We have a
King of Slackline 2011!
In the first round there were 153 participants, in the second even 155, but
just Jaan Roose and Carlos Neto could make it to the “Final Round”. Until the
end it was an exciting head to head run, but one could make one round more:
JAAN ROOSE! Congratulation and welcome to the International Pro-Team of GIBBON!

New World Record over running Jing Po Waterfall
GIBBON Pro Team Rider Andy Lewis breaks his first World Record over the running Jing Po Waterfall in China!
After his first official Guinness World Record (as many surfs as
possible in a minute) at the beginning of the year in Italy Andy could
break his first record with 138 surfs up to 143 surfs in a minute!A month ago you could watch it at the Chinese TV Show at CCTV1 - now it is also online at YouTube! Enjoy
